Andover Business - Andover Animal Hospital

From Andover Answers
Revision as of 11:35, 21 December 2010 by Dean (talk | contribs)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

The Andover Animal Hospital is located at 233 Lowell Street in Andover. The facility was opened by Dr. Lindsay in 1958 and was taken over in 1999 by his daughter Dr. Diane Lindsay Tower.


  • "Shadow leaders", The Andover Townsman, February 5, 2009.
  • "Students shadow 'Great Women to Know'", The Andover Townsman, February 11, 2010.
  • Andover Animal Hospital website

back to Main Page

--Jen 9:58, November 16, 2010 (EST)